    Understanding the Conversion: 1 Tablespoon Olive Oil = ? Grams

    The conversion of tablespoons to grams for olive oil isn't a fixed, absolute number. Several factors contribute to the slight variations you might encounter:

    • Olive Oil Type: Different olive oils, such as extra virgin, virgin, or refined, have slightly varying densities due to differences in their chemical composition and processing. Extra virgin olive oil, with its higher concentration of naturally occurring compounds, might have a slightly different density compared to refined olive oil.

    • Temperature: Temperature affects the density of liquids. A tablespoon of olive oil measured at room temperature (around 20°C or 68°F) will have a slightly different weight compared to the same volume measured at a higher or lower temperature.

    • Measurement Accuracy: The accuracy of your tablespoon measurement plays a crucial role. A slightly heaped tablespoon will weigh more than a level tablespoon.

    Despite these variations, a generally accepted approximation is that one tablespoon of olive oil weighs approximately 14 grams. This is a useful benchmark for most culinary and nutritional calculations. However, for highly precise applications, it's advisable to use a kitchen scale for accurate measurement.

    Practical Applications: Recipes and Calculations

    Let's explore how the gram equivalent of a tablespoon of olive oil can be used practically:

    Example 1: A Salad Dressing Recipe

    A recipe calls for 2 tablespoons of olive oil. Using the approximate conversion of 14 grams per tablespoon, this would equate to approximately 28 grams of olive oil (2 tablespoons x 14 grams/tablespoon).

    Example 2: Calorie Calculation

    Olive oil contains approximately 120 calories per tablespoon. Knowing that a tablespoon is roughly 14 grams, we can calculate the calorie density: approximately 8.6 calories per gram (120 calories / 14 grams). This allows us to accurately calculate the calorie content of dishes containing various amounts of olive oil.
